WebEducation & Outreach. NGRA believes strongly in the extension and outreach function and its role in ensuring the commercial adoption of scientific advances. We require that all projects we support include a well-conceived extension component, and we ensure that outreach specialists feel connected and supported at a national level. WebThe ‘Blanc du Bois’ grape was developed in 1968 when Mortensen crossed PD-resistant, native Florida grapes with susceptible V. vinifera selections, resulting in a wine grape resistant to PD - a significant development. When Mortensen retired in 1990, the formal breeding program ended, but UF/IFAS grape research continued. WebMar 8, 2024 · National Grape Research Alliance. @GrapeResearch.
